- The distance between Kushka, Turkmenistan and Sydney, Nova Scotia, Canada is approximately 9,281 km or 5,767 mi.
- To reach Kushka in this distance one would set out from Sydney, Nova Scotia bearing 43.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kushka bearing 143.9° or SE .
- Kushka has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Sydney, Nova Scotia has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Kushka is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Sydney, Nova Scotia is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 8.9 °C (16.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.9 °C (3.4°F) more in Kushka.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1234.2 mm (48.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1234.2 l/m² (30.29 US gal/ft²) or 12,342,000 l/ha (1,319,442 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- There are 1177 more hours of sunlight per year in Kushka. In whichever way circa 3h 12' more per day or about 1 2/3 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.9° higher in Kushka than in Sydney, Nova Scotia.
- Relative humidity levels are 19.1%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2.9°C (5.3°F) higher.
